During the New Orleans Jazz & Heritage Festival, we were very lucky to be with Relix for their event "Relix Celebrates 50 Years of New Orleans Music and Culture" at the New Orleans Jazz Museum.

For several months to come, the Women of Note, Fats Domino, and Pete Fountain rooms each have a pair of UP-4slim and MM-10ACX systems to power the sound of the rooms. Each room has artwork by artists that have shaped New Orleans culture and plays back the Smithsonian Folkways Recordings' box set “Jazz Fest: The New Orleans Jazz & Heritage Festival” as the soundtrack.

In the museum's Performing Arts Center is a house Meyer Sound system with two UPJ-1P loudspeakers, four UPQ-2P loudspeakers, and two 500-HP subwoofers. Four MJF-208 stage monitors have been added to power the performances and panel discussions for the event.
